When chondrocytes from the Swarm rat chondrosarcoma are isolated by trypsin and collagenase digestion and cultured in Petri dishes, they form a new extracellular matrix within 24 hours, with proteoglycan matrix granules and collagen fibrils. This rapid synthesis of new matrix, together with the biochemical and morphological characterization of the proteoglycans as typical of cartilage, demonstrates the value of these cultures as a model system for studies of synthesis, secretion, and organization of extracellular matrix.
